But without faith it is impossible to please him: for he that cometh to God must believe that he is, and that he is a rewarder of them that diligently seek him. (Hebrews 11:6) Notice particularly the first part of that verse, "But without faith it is impossible to please him...." If God demands that we have faith when it is impossible for us to have faith, then we have a right to challenge his justice. But if he places within our hands the means whereby faith can be produced, then the responsibility rests with us as to whether or not we have faith. God has told us that without faith it is impossible to please him, but he has also told us how to obtain faith. He has told us how faith comes. ROMANS 10:17 So then faith cometh by hearing, and hearing by the word of God. If we don't have faith, it is not God's fault. To blame God for our lack of faith is nothing but ignorance. God has provided the way whereby everyone can have faith. Faith for Salvation Faith for salvation "cometh by hearing, and hearing by the word of God." The Apostle Paul said that we are saved by faith. "For by grace are ye saved through faith; and that not of exceedingly growing faith yourselves: it is the gift of God" (Eph. 2:8). But how do you get the faith to be saved?

Author Glen Striemer brings clarity to this confusing and often misunderstood topic in the Bible. He takes the listener on a thought-provoking tour from the first pure fruits in the Garden of Eden, to the drunken feasts of the Old Testament kings, to the warnings of the prophets against wine, to the use of wine and what it symbolized in the sanctuary service, to the meaning of the Nazrene vow, and to the use of wine in the communion service. The effects of alcohol on various parts of the body are discussed, along with a warning to Christians and about the use of wine and alcoholic beverages. Alcohol has been the biggest curse and tool of Satan since creation. The author challenges all Christians to remember they are now part of the royal priesthood forbidden to drink alcohol. With God's help, they are to live a sanctified life without alcohol in the days just prior to Christ’s return.
